GRAMMAR

The present passive


- structure
subject verb object

The company carries out 12.500 jobs

12,500 jobs are carried out by the company


subject verb (be + pp) agent
- We use the passive form when we don’t know, or it is unimportant, who has performed an
action. The passive is often used to describe technical processes, where we are more interested in
the process itself rather than who or what is responsable for it
- If we want to mention who or what has done something, we use the word “by”.
Examples:
Active Passive
We use a system called “power planning” A system called “power planning” is used
The Work Finder arranges the schedules Schedules are arranged by the Work Finder

THE PAST PASSIVE


1 We use the past passive when:
- We don’t know, or it is unimportant, who performed the action
- We are more interested in the result of the action than who did it.
2 Past passive sentences structure
Subject verb object

Subject be (past simple)+PP agent


3 If we want to say who performed the action, we use the word “by”
Examples: The accounts were audited by “Reynolds” LTD
The accounts were not audited by “Reynolds” LTD
